Unplanned
Last Updated: 16 Apr 2019 13:53 by ADMIN
Created by: Jeremy
Comments: 0
Type: Feature Request
0

Currently Test Studio supports Toggle calendar action and selecting date from the visible month when automating Kendo Angular datepicker. 

It will be helpful if the support is extended and setting the date directly in the KendoInput is also an option. As of now using Actions.SetText() is not triggering the necessary events and real user behavior is required to handle the scenario. 

Depending on the exact implementation, a coded step may be required to enter valid date. 

Unplanned
Last Updated: 04 Apr 2019 11:17 by ADMIN

Create folder hierarchy in {project}\Data\ folder to organize the external data sources.
For example:

{project}\Data\UserData\abc.csv

{project}\Data\CompanyData\def.csv

Unplanned
Last Updated: 27 Mar 2019 14:22 by ADMIN
Created by: Jim Holmes
Comments: 3
Type: Feature Request
0

I'm unable to shrink the width of the Test Explorer and Element Explorer.

In the attached file I'm unable to move the bar (highlighted with the red line) at all to the left.

I'd like to be able to shrink the width to the left, as both panes take up more room than necessary.

 

(SIDE NOTE: For some reason, the required "Version" drop-down only gave me versions way back to 2014. I'm on 2019.1.212.0)

Unplanned
Last Updated: 20 Mar 2019 12:49 by ADMIN
ADMIN
Created by: Andy Wieland
Comments: 1
Type: Feature Request
4
Even for a small sample of performance results, the load time is painfully long.  Can you please load the History Tab values (total test times, over time) faster without needing to query the complete detailed result set?  Possibly the query can continue loading in the background, after first displaying the high-level data.
Thanks
Unplanned
Last Updated: 19 Mar 2019 16:45 by ADMIN
Created by: Zach
Comments: 0
Type: Feature Request
0

Hi Team,

Wondering if it's feasible to offer official support for electron-based apps at some point in the near term. Since the framework already utilizes front-end technology, is this something that we may be able to incorporate into a future release?

Thanks!

Unplanned
Last Updated: 11 Mar 2019 15:15 by ADMIN

Good morning,

When checking in, the full path and name of the test is not viewable, even though  there is space in the window.

 

 

Thanks

 

Ruth

Unplanned
Last Updated: 11 Mar 2019 13:23 by ADMIN
Chrome cannot be started with the required by Test Studio arguments when the "Application Identity" service is enabled in Windows 10 and as a result cannot record or execute tests with Test Studio. 

It will be beneficial to investigate the case on our end and identify if there is anything we could improve or at least document the known issue. 

A workaround could be to either disable that service or to add an exception for Chrome in an AppLocker rule to exclude it from the respective GPO. 
Unplanned
Last Updated: 08 Mar 2019 17:39 by ADMIN
Steps to reproduce: 

1. Use Run->To Here against Chrome or Firefox. 

2. Once the recorder is attached immediately hit the Pause button. 

Expected: The recorder is paused. 

Actual: The recorder is displayed as paused but it actually still records steps. 
Unplanned
Last Updated: 08 Mar 2019 16:49 by ADMIN
Adding an event listener to an input element to catch Oninput and OnChange events isn't working. 
Unplanned
Last Updated: 06 Mar 2019 16:31 by Thomas

When attempting to get data related to what is being displayed in the RadCartesianChart I cannot read the nested properties under the Path's Tag field. When retrieving the Tag property it is returned as a string and appears to be pre-populated in the propsBag as a String property

The Path WebAii element has a Data field which returns nested properties for the Geometry, but I do not see similar functionality for the Tag field.  Is this supported or is there guidance on implementing a custom AutomationObject to provide deserilazation and access to the nested properties?  If not can you provided details on the difference to why Data is supported, but not Tag?  Thank you!

Unplanned
Last Updated: 01 Mar 2019 17:09 by dan
in a specific situation with old OnBeforeUnload dialogs appearing, if you have a test list with setting to HandleAndFail execution on unexpected dialog appearing, what happens upon execution is that dialog is handled, but test passes instead of failing, in execution log there is nothing logged that unexpected dialog is shown and handled, but in test studio log there is a strange log that indicates OnBeforeUnload dialog is added to collection, while there is no dialog defined in the test:
Unplanned
Last Updated: 27 Feb 2019 15:43 by ADMIN
Test Studio recorder is not successfully attached to the second window of a WPF application, when the first (login) window is closed in the same time. There is not enough time for Test Studio to attach the recorder before the connection is lost and we are not able to record any steps or use the highlighter.
Unplanned
Last Updated: 26 Feb 2019 10:19 by ADMIN

After changing the project name and assembly name, the remote execution is failing with FileNotFoundException for the assembly_name.dll. The execution is referring to the old assembly name, even though the correct one is generated in the bin folder.

Additionally there is not such error in local execution.

The workaround for this behavior is to also change the namespace.

Unplanned
Last Updated: 25 Feb 2019 09:09 by ADMIN
Created by: Ed
Comments: 0
Type: Bug Report
0
While recording the custom web app, there are multiple exceptions in the log file, highlighting isn't working consistently, recording hangs. 
Unplanned
Last Updated: 25 Feb 2019 09:00 by ADMIN
Created by: Chris
Comments: 4
Type: Feature Request
0
JSON viewer/ XML viewer for the responses detected based on the ACCEPT as JSON or XML for example
    Could really expand on this.  Click on a JSON key/pair and automatically add to verification.  (ie. That element must be this)

Unplanned
Last Updated: 21 Feb 2019 12:50 by ADMIN

Specific customer's project cannot be compiled. Elements with a specific name generates error in the Pages.g.cs file. 

Details shared internally! 

Unplanned
Last Updated: 21 Feb 2019 09:06 by ADMIN
Created by: dan
Comments: 1
Type: Feature Request
0

How do I get rid of this message panel that occupies almost half of the edit window? It's there every time I got to edit an element I have to constantly drag it off to one side.

I don't need to see it every time I edit. This is very annoying. 

 

 

Unplanned
Last Updated: 19 Feb 2019 09:29 by ADMIN
Created by: Chris
Comments: 3
Type: Feature Request
0
Button to save a step.  Currently you have to navigate to file menu, use Ctrl-S or Run the Script.

Unplanned
Last Updated: 19 Feb 2019 09:22 by ADMIN

'Validate Expression' button in the Find Expression Builder is not showing the correct element after changing the find expression and not reloading the opened element's pane. 

Steps to reproduce: 

1. Open an element and edit its find expression

Actual: Regardless if saved or not. validating the element still shows the previous element. 

Expected: Validating the element to highlight the correct element. 

Workaround: The issue could be avoided with reopening the element to be edited. 
1. Open the element and edit the find expression. 

2. Save and close the edit element pane. 

3. Open that again to validate the element - the correct one will be highlighted. 

Unplanned
Last Updated: 19 Feb 2019 08:08 by ADMIN

Both the embedded API and Test studio compiled, but the assemblies in API bin folder are not rebuilt. The tests are failing with the following error: 

Could not load file or assembly 'Telerik.ApiTesting.Framework, Version=2018.3.927.1751, Culture=neutral, PublicKeyToken=5a31053920bb0a73' or one of its dependencies. The system cannot find the file specified.

In order to fix it, we had to manually delete the files in the Embedded API bin files.

Check log below.

Overall Result: Fail

------------------------------------------------------------
'14/02/2019 12:50:56' - Executing test: 'Space_AreaAvailability', path: 'SmokeTest\Space\Space_AreaAvailability.tstest.'
'14/02/2019 12:50:56' - Using .Net Runtime version: '4.0.30319.42000' for test execution. Build version is '2019.1.212.0'.
'14/02/2019 12:50:56' - Starting execution....
'14/02/2019 12:51:01' - Detected custom code in test. Locating test assembly: CAPlusSmokeTest.dll.
'14/02/2019 12:51:01' - Assembly Found: C:\Shireburn\Testing\Shireburn.Testing\CAPlus\TestStudio\CAPlusSmokeTest\bin\CAPlusSmokeTest.dll
'14/02/2019 12:51:01' - Loading code class: 'CAPlusSmokeTest.Space_AreaAvailability'.
------------------------------------------------------------
Overall Result: Fail
------------------------------------------------------------
'14/02/2019 12:51:01' - Detected custom code in test. Locating test assembly: CAPlusSmokeTest.dll.
'14/02/2019 12:51:01' - Assembly Found: C:\Shireburn\Testing\Shireburn.Testing\CAPlus\TestStudio\CAPlusSmokeTest\bin\CAPlusSmokeTest.dll
'14/02/2019 12:51:01' - Loading code class: 'CAPlusSmokeTest.SetCookie'.
------------------------------------------------------------
------------------------------------------------------------
'14/02/2019 12:51:01' - Enabling Html Popup Tracker. Test expecting Popups.
'14/02/2019 12:51:01' - Using 'Chrome' version '72.0.3626.109' as default browser. 
'14/02/2019 12:51:01' - Using 'http://<valid url name>.com' as base url.
'14/02/2019 12:51:01' - LOG: Executing API Test as Step: '.\User Session Token', arguments: 'test --verbose-variables -p "C:\Shireburn\Testing\Shireburn.Testing\CAPlus\TestStudio\CAPlusSmokeTest\ApiTests" -t ".\User Session Token" -v "base-url="XXXXXXXXXX"'" -v "username="XXXXXXXXXX"'" -v "password=XXXXXXXXXX"'
'14/02/2019 12:51:02' - LOG: 12:51:02.659 [INFO]  Project compile started.
'14/02/2019 12:51:02' - LOG: 12:51:02.676 [INFO]  Project compile completed.
'14/02/2019 12:51:02' - LOG: 12:51:02.725 [INFO]  [START]   Test Case 'User Session Token' [.\User Session Token]
'14/02/2019 12:51:02' - LOG: 12:51:02.742 [ERROR] Could not load file or assembly 'Telerik.ApiTesting.Framework, Version=2018.3.927.1751, Culture=neutral, PublicKeyToken=5a31053920bb0a73' or one of its dependencies. The system cannot find the file specified.
'14/02/2019 12:51:02' - LOG: 12:51:02.745 [ERROR] [FAILED]  Test Case 'User Session Token' [28 ms] [.\User Session Token]
'14/02/2019 12:51:02' - LOG: 12:51:02.750 Finished.
'14/02/2019 12:51:02' - 'Fail' : 1. Execute API test 'User Session Token'
------------------------------------------------------------
Failure Information: 
~~~~~~~~~~~~~~~
API test execution failed.
Test error log:
12:51:02.745 [ERROR] [FAILED]  Test Case 'User Session Token' [28 ms] [.\User Session Token]

------------------------------------------------------------
'14/02/2019 12:51:02' - Detected a failure. Step is marked 'ContinueOnFailure=False' aborting test execution.
------------------------------------------------------------
'14/02/2019 12:51:02' - Overall Result: Fail
'14/02/2019 12:51:02' - Duration: [0 min: 1 sec: 397 msec]
------------------------------------------------------------